Hi! If you add more nodes to your cluster, you'll get performance boost, because queries will be executed in a distributed manner. But this boost will be noticeable only starting from some particular data volume, because distributed query execution is associated with some overhead.
You will also get higher durability, if you configure backups for partitions. In this case you will be protected from data loss, when some nodes are failing.
